MDM-Embarking on CRM 2.0? Then You Know It’s All About The Data
Arguably the top lesson of CRM 1.0 was simply this—data matters. Though CRM 1.0 promised to deliver a 360-degree customer view, untold numbers of multimillion-dollar CRM systems fell short of expectations because they failed to address the incomplete, incorrect, inconsistent and duplicate data that proliferated across the enterprise.
Now companies are moving to CRM 2.0, in many cases to the cloud with salesforce.com or another software as a service (SaaS) provider. And this time, determined to get the data right, many businesses are looking to master data management (MDM) and data quality to generate a true 360-degree customer view. (more…)
